数据库 · 14 10 月, 2024

MSSQL中查看表結構的方法(mssql顯示表結構)

MSSQL中查看表結構的方法(mssql顯示表結構)

在使用Microsoft SQL Server(MSSQL)進行數據庫管理時,了解表的結構是非常重要的。表結構包含了有關表中數據的類型、約束條件及其關聯性的信息。本文將介紹幾種在MSSQL中查看表結構的方法,幫助用戶更有效地管理和操作數據庫。

1. 使用SQL Server Management Studio (SSMS)

SQL Server Management Studio(SSMS)是一個功能強大的工具,提供了直觀的用戶界面來管理SQL Server數據庫。要查看表結構,可以按照以下步驟操作:

  1. 打開SSMS並連接到數據庫伺服器。
  2. 在“對象資源管理器”中,展開數據庫節點。
  3. 找到並展開“表”節點。
  4. 右鍵單擊所需的表,選擇“設計”選項。

這樣就可以看到該表的所有列及其屬性,包括數據類型、長度、是否允許空值等。

2. 使用T-SQL查詢

除了使用SSMS,還可以通過T-SQL查詢來查看表結構。以下是幾個常用的查詢示例:

2.1 使用INFORMATION_SCHEMA.COLUMNS


SELECT 
    COLUMN_NAME, 
    DATA_TYPE, 
    CHARACTER_MAXIMUM_LENGTH, 
    IS_NULLABLE 
FROM 
    INFORMATION_SCHEMA.COLUMNS 
WHERE 
    TABLE_NAME = '你的表名';

這個查詢將返回指定表的所有列名、數據類型、最大字符長度及是否允許空值的信息。

2.2 使用sys.columns


SELECT 
    c.name AS ColumnName, 
    t.name AS DataType, 
    c.max_length AS MaxLength, 
    c.is_nullable AS IsNullable 
FROM 
    sys.columns c
JOIN 
    sys.types t ON c.user_type_id = t.user_type_id
WHERE 
    c.object_id = OBJECT_ID('你的表名');

這個查詢提供了更詳細的列信息,包括列名、數據類型、最大長度及是否允許空值。

3. 使用sp_help存儲過程

MSSQL還提供了一個內建的存儲過程sp_help,可以快速查看表的結構。使用方法如下:


EXEC sp_help '你的表名';

這個命令將返回該表的所有列信息、索引、約束條件等,方便用戶快速了解表的整體結構。

4. 使用SQL Server Data Tools (SSDT)

SQL Server Data Tools(SSDT)是一個集成開發環境,專為數據庫開發而設計。用戶可以在SSDT中打開數據庫項目,然後查看表的結構。這種方法特別適合需要進行數據庫設計和版本控制的開發者。

總結

了解如何查看MSSQL中的表結構對於數據庫管理至關重要。無論是使用SSMS、T-SQL查詢、sp_help存儲過程還是SSDT,這些方法都能幫助用戶快速獲取所需的信息。掌握這些技巧後,用戶將能夠更有效地管理數據庫,提升工作效率。

如果您正在尋找高效的 VPS 解決方案,Server.HK 提供多種選擇,滿足不同需求的用戶。無論是 香港VPS 還是其他服務,我們都能為您提供穩定可靠的支持。